Q. Two stones are thrown up simultaneously from the edge of a cliff $240\, m$ high with initial speed of $10\, m/s$ and $40\, m/s$ respectively. Which of the following graph best represents the time variation of relative position of the second stone with respect to the first? (Assume stones do not rebound after hitting the ground and neglect air resistance, take $g=10\, m/s^2$)
